Category: AMOS

Games Created with the AMOS programming language by Europress Software / Francois Lionet and Constantin Sotiropoulos – There were several versions of AMOS released, AMOS 1.3 in 1991, Easy AMOS in 1992, and AMOS Professional also in 1992, along with AMOS 3D
